  • Here's something I put together to pay tribute to my grandfather. You heard him sing and seen him entertain, now hear him talk. Here is a rare interview of Jackie Wilson giving an account of his life, career, influences, and tragedies. I think you will enjoy this interview if you haven't heard it nor ever heard him talk. Jackie speaks beautifully and articulately. He is charming, witty, humorous, and very down to earth as if he's speaking to you. He talks of his friends Sam Cooke, Elvis Presley, and he talks of Berry Gordy and Motown. The interview is close to 15 miutes long. This is a tribute to him, and for the fans if you haven't ever heard him talk or give an interview. Since there hasn't been a documentary nor a story done on Jackie's life, and since everyone has had their say about him, he can have his say now. I hope you enjoy the interview and the beautiful photos of my fantastic grandfather the one and only Jackie Wilson.

    A close friend of mine blues singer Elmore James had a hit record in 1960 (I can't hold out) and was on the show with Jackie Wilson at the Regal theater in Chicago. I was able to watch the show from back stage and stood next to Jackie as he argued with his girlfriend. When he was introduced he danced backward onto the stage to "That all I need". The last time I saw him was in Birmingham, Al. at the Boom Boom Room 1972The process was gone and he was still one great entertainer. RIP JW
